
Sunny Deol's star is at its peak these days. His film Gadar 2, released last year, created a stir at the box office. This film, which tells the story of Gadar in 2002, proved to be an all-time blockbuster. After this film, various types of news have started coming in regarding the sequels of Sunny Deol's other films. Sunny is facing many types of rumors regarding the next part of her superhit films.
These also include the names of 'Border 2' and 'Gadar 3'. The actor is quite surprised by such assumptions being made by people. During a recent conversation, Sunny spoke openly on this issue. He said that such speculations have started since 'Gadar 2' and people are speculating about the sequels of the films. Sunny said that he is now fed up with these things. The actor took the matter further and said that he would announce it himself, but people like to believe what they hear.
Talking about Sunny Deol's upcoming project, these days the actor is seen in 'Lahore 1947' being made under the banner of Aamir Khan's production house. The film is being directed by Rajkumar Santoshi. Before this, the pair of Santoshi and Sunny have given many superhit films together.
Sunny said that Santoshi is a talented director and he always comes up with many good subjects. The two have made three films together and despite having different genres, they all managed to deliver great performances. He further said that he would like to work only on films which he likes.
The actor made it clear that instead of worrying about what people will accept and think, he would like to do the film as per his wish. He said that he understands the expectations of the audience and fans, but he is not ready to be insecure about how people will react to his films.
